- mango_saplingJun 20, 2020 · 6 years agoSetting a stop loss in KuCoin is an essential risk management strategy for cryptocurrency traders. To set a stop loss in KuCoin, you can follow these steps: 1. Log in to your KuCoin account and navigate to the trading page. 2. Select the cryptocurrency pair you want to trade. 3. Locate the stop loss order section and enter the desired stop price. 4. Set the stop loss order type, such as market or limit order. 5. Specify the quantity of the cryptocurrency you want to sell if the stop loss is triggered. 6. Review the order details and click on the 'Place Order' button to submit your stop loss order. When setting a stop loss in KuCoin, it is important to consider the volatility of the cryptocurrency market and your risk tolerance. Additionally, make sure to double-check the order details before submitting to avoid any mistakes. Remember, a stop loss order is not a guarantee that your trade will be executed at the desired price. It is designed to limit your potential losses by automatically selling your cryptocurrency if the price reaches a certain level. Happy trading on KuCoin!
